Description
The BGC420 is a silicon self biased RF
Transistor (Q1). It offers an adjustable collector current nearly independent from device voltage in the range from 2.0V to 4.5V. Additionally a control pin (Vc) for switching the device off is provided. The collector current can be adjusted by connecting a resistor (Rx) between Vcc and Vr.
